Matlab 2025 hangs itself whenever I try to plot a figure

136 views (last 30 days)
I used MATLAB 2025b on a Windows 11 and whenever I try to plot a figure MATLAB hanged itself and I had to kill it in the task manager. Even a simple plot caused this. At first I suspected that my external monitor causes this because on that Simulink fonts are to big and when I move the Simulink window to the laptop monitor it is ok (on moving back it is to big again). It turned out that the problem is that starting MATLAB 2025a MATLAB does not use Java ( https://www.mathworks.com/matlabcentral/answers/2179665-how-can-i-enable-java-in-matlab-r2025a-and-newer ) and this is the problem (turning on Java did not help). My current workarround is that I moved back to MATLAB 2024b and now everything works fine. Does anybody have an idea how to fix this?

Hello,
I also had the same problem. I still don't know why, but it started working properly once I removed my startup.m script. I used this script to make changes in default plot configuration, so I supose that was the problem.
